Hi. Currently i have a Marantz PM17KI and CD17KI set up running a pair of Castle Richmond 7i speakers. These are linked by Nordost Flatline Gold speaker cable. I am looking at purchasing new speakers to give the set up some extra boost to my listening experience.

What do people suggest would be a good choice. My budget is £1000-£1500. I listen to mostly vocal music, acoustic in nature but love Pink Floyd and Dave Gilmore.

Your advice is greatly received.

Hi vinnie66

The PM17ki and CD17KI are excellent components. I used to sell these. Are your units in black or gold finish?

Anyway, your impression/thoughts of your current system are?

Floorstanding speakers?

The size of your room?

Room positioning of the new speakers (distance to walls, corners, will there be anything between the speakers such as a chimney breast, cabinet, windows etc.)?

Distance between the speakers?

Listening distance?

Your general listening level?

Do you use the bass/treble controls on the PM17KI?

With new speakers what areas of improvement are you looking for over your 7i's?
